On Fri, 18 Oct 2024 17:57:42 +0800
Yicong Yang <yangyicong@huawei.com> wrote:

> From: Yicong Yang <yangyicong@hisilicon.com>
> 
> Each type of HiSilicon Uncore PMU has the following sysfs attributes:
> 
> - format: bitmask in perf_event_attr::config[012] of corresponding
>   attribute
> - event: events name and corresponding event code
> - cpumask: range of CPUs the events can be opened on
> - identifier: the version of this PMU
> 
> Different types of PMU have different implementations of the "format"
> and "event" but all share the same implementation of the "cpumask"
> and "identifier". Thus we can move cpumask and identifier to the
> hisi_uncore_pmu framework and drivers can use the generic
> implementation.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Yicong Yang <yangyicong@hisilicon.com>

Is there a reason to move to code setting all 4 elements vs
just using the extern struct attribute_group in the static const arrays?

e.g.
static const struct attribute_group *hisi_uc_pmu_attr_groups[] = {
	&hisi_uc_pmu_format_group,
	&hisi_uc_pmu_events_group,
	&hisi_pmu_cpumask_attr_group,
	&hisi_pmu_identifier_group,
	NULL
};
mixing attributes defined in each module with those coming from the core module?

For the cases where it varies between versions of the PMU, just have a bunch
of such arrays to pick from.

I might be missing some subtle issue, but a really quick hack shows it builds
fine.

Jonathan
